Default can't open general templates - not enough memory or disk space


Trying to pull up general templates in Word. File... New... and clicks on
General Templates on the right side. The following error comes up: there is
not enough memory or disk space to complete the operation.

This just started happening. Have rebooted the computer but still can't get
to General Templates. Are there settings I can check for this? Is there a
minimum amount of memory that a computer needs? We currently have 512 MB of
RAM.
